Description

A Web Producer is a skilled professional responsible for overseeing and managing the development and maintenance of a company's website. They collaborate with cross-functional teams, such as web designers, developers, and content creators, to ensure that the website meets the company's goals and objectives. Web Producers are involved in the entire website lifecycle, from initial concept and design to ongoing updates and enhancements. They are responsible for creating and implementing project plans, setting timelines, and managing resources to ensure that projects are completed on time and within budget. Web Producers also conduct regular website audits to identify and address issues related to content quality, user experience, and technical performance. They monitor website analytics and user feedback to gain insights and make data-driven recommendations for website improvements. They have a strong understanding of web development technologies such as HTML, CSS, and JavaScript, as well as content management systems and multimedia production tools. Web Producers must also possess excellent communication and organizational skills, as they often work with multiple stakeholders and manage competing priorities. Overall, a Web Producer plays a crucial role in ensuring that a company's website is well-designed, user-friendly, and aligned with the organization's branding and marketing strategies.

Roles & Responsibilities

As a Web Producer with 0-3 years of experience in Australia, your main responsibilities include:

  • Collaborating with cross-functional teams to develop and maintain website content, ensuring it aligns with the organization's objectives and brand guidelines. This involves working with different departments to create and update website content while ensuring it reflects the organization's goals and brand identity.
  • Conducting quality assurance checks to ensure the website functions properly across different browsers and devices. You will be responsible for testing the website's functionality and compatibility on various browsers and devices to ensure a seamless user experience.
  • Assisting in the implementation of digital marketing strategies, including SEO optimization and content promotion. You will support the execution of digital marketing campaigns, including optimizing website content for search engines and promoting it through various channels.
  • Monitoring website analytics and generating reports to identify areas for improvement and optimize user engagement.

Qualifications & Work Experience

For a Web Producer, the following qualifications are required:

  • Proficiency in web development languages such as HTML, CSS, and JavaScript to effectively manage and update website content.
  • Strong knowledge of content management systems (CMS) like WordPress or Drupal to maintain and optimize website performance.
  • Experience in web analytics tools, such as Google Analytics, to track and analyze website traffic, user behavior, and conversions.
  • Excellent project management skills to coordinate with cross-functional teams and deliver web projects within deadlines.

Career Prospects

For a Web Producer job role with 0-3 years of experience in Australia, there are several alternative roles to consider. Here are four options worth exploring:

  • Content Coordinator: This role involves managing and organizing website content, ensuring its accuracy, relevance, and adherence to brand guidelines. It may also include coordinating with writers, designers, and developers to ensure a seamless content creation process.
  • Digital Marketing Assistant: In this role, you would assist in developing and implementing digital marketing campaigns, including social media management, email marketing, and search engine optimization. It offers an opportunity to gain experience in various digital marketing channels.
  • UX/UI Designer: As a UX/UI designer, you would focus on creating intuitive and visually appealing website interfaces. This role involves understanding user needs, conducting usability testing, and collaborating with developers to implement design changes.
  • SEO Specialist: This role revolves around optimizing websites to improve their search engine rankings.
